Profil
Mikhail Damrin is currently the Chief Executive Officer at Kopy Goldfields AB since 2010.
He is also a Director at Krasny LLC and Kopy Development AB.
Previously, he worked as a Commercial Director at West Siberian Resources Ltd.
from 2000 to 2004.
He was also a Director & Partner at Amur Gold LLC, Chief Financial Officer at Vostok Gas Ltd., Manager-Business Development at ACH Securities SA, and Senior Manager-Project at Auriant Mining AB.
Mr. Damrin holds an MBA from Cranfield University, an undergraduate degree from All-Union Academy of Foreign Trade, an undergraduate degree from Tomsk Polytechnic University, and has studied at Moscow State Mining University and Russian Technological University.

Vostok Gas Ltd.
Vostok Gas Ltd. Investment Trusts/Mutual FundsMiscellaneous Vostok Gas Ltd. (Vostok) (ST: VGAS) is an investment company focused on the Russian gas industry, and as of 2009 in liquidation. Previously known as Vostok Nafta Investment Ltd., Vostok was incorporated in Bermuda in 1996 and is based in Stockholm. The company's shareholders are Swedish and international institutions, as well as Swedish private individuals. The founding Lundin family holds a significant minority interest. Vostok's investment activities are carried out in the international arena through Bermudan, Cypriot and Swedish group entities. Managing the group's interest in Gazprom became the main purpose of Vostok in 2007. The company owns close to one and a half percent of the Gazprom shares. Gazprom controls a significant part of the world's known gas reserves. Vostok's non-Gazprom assets were spun off into a Bermuda-domiciled company known as Vostok Nafta Investment Ltd., also part of the Vostok Nafta Group.
